A single Amanita muscaria mushroom, also known as a fly agaric, is pictured growing amongst dried leaves, pine needles, and blades of grass. The mushroom has a bright red cap dotted with white spots and a white stem. The surrounding environment appears to be a forest floor, with fallen twigs and branches scattered throughout. The lighting suggests it is daytime, possibly overcast, as there are no strong shadows. The image is focused on the mushroom, with the background slightly blurred. The location is Degtyarsk, Russia.
